Parking Lot Dispute Escalates to Assault and Theft for Elderly Florida Woman
An 80-year-old Florida woman was recently arrested following a parking lot altercation at a Walmart in Apopka that escalated into a slap and the alleged theft of a cell phone.
Linda Montan Frenier faces charges of felony robbery by sudden snatching and misdemeanor battery after the incident on June 30.

According to Orange County court records, Frenier’s vehicle struck another car while she was backing out of a parking spot.
The victim stated that after she exited her car to exchange insurance information, Frenier began to curse at her and then allegedly slapped her in the face.

Following the slap, Frenier reportedly snatched the victim’s cell phone and threw it across the street.
A witness corroborated the victim’s account, and Frenier allegedly confessed to the acts after being arrested.
